The Dragon Tower has a single path that leads to the Crown of Command, and characters move along the spiralling staircase by drawing cards from the Dragon King’s deck. http://www.talismanwiki.com/Category%3ADragon_Tower_Region
The Dragon Realm has a similar layout to the Inner Region from the main game board, but the challenges on each space grow even more dangerous as the number of dragon scales on the Draconic Lord Cards increases. http://www.talismanwiki.com/Category%3ADragon_Realm_Region
